Understanding C9S26 Ranking System & Point Requirements

Current Season Point Distribution

PUBG Mobile ranking system interface showing RP points and tier progression

Here’s what most guides won’t tell you: PUBG Mobile’s RP calculation isn’t just about kills anymore. Survival time carries the heaviest weight, followed by kills/assists (they’re weighted equally now), damage dealt, and placement bonuses.

Erangel and Miramar? They’re your best friends for point farming. Longer matches = more survival time = bigger RP gains. Sanhok might feel faster, but you’re leaving points on the table.

The Conqueror threshold is dynamic - and this is crucial. Early season, you might sneak in at 4200 RP. Wait too long? You’re looking at 7000+ RP. Time is literally points in this game.

A15 to Conqueror Point Gap Analysis

TPP Mode Requirements:

  • Squad: 5000 RP (early) to 7000 RP (late season)

  • Duo: 4500 RP (early) to 6000 RP (late)

  • Solo: 4500 RP (early) to 5500 RP (late)

FPP Mode Requirements:

  • Squad: 4500 RP (early) to 6000 RP (late)

  • Duo: 4200 RP (early) to 5000 RP (late)

  • Solo: 4200 RP (early) to 5000 RP (late)

Starting from A15 at 4200 RP, you need anywhere from 0 to 2800 additional points. FPP is your secret weapon here - smaller player pool, lower competition. I’ve seen players hit Conqueror in FPP with points that wouldn’t even crack Ace in TPP.

One thing that’ll bite you: rank decay. After 7 days of inactivity, Master loses 7 RP daily, Diamond loses 5. Don’t take breaks during this grind.

7-Day Progression Timeline & Daily Goals

Day 1-2: A15 to Crown Strategy

PUBG Mobile Erangel map showing recommended landing zones for ranking strategy

This is your aggressive phase. 15-20 matches daily, targeting 5+ kills while maintaining top 10 finishes. Sounds contradictory? It’s not.

Land medium-traffic zones - Georgopol containers, Yasnaya apartments. You want action, but not the chaos of School or Pochinki. Third-party everything. Let other squads weaken each other, then clean up. It’s not honorable, but honor doesn’t get you Conqueror.

Daily target: 200-300 RP gain. Miss this, and your 7-day timeline becomes 10-14 days.

Day 3-4: Crown to Ace Transition

Welcome to the Survivor Phase. Your playstyle needs to shift dramatically here. 10-15 matches daily, but now you’re playing like your life depends on it - because your rank does.

Position over aggression. Only fight when you have clear advantages. Use terrain religiously during rotations. Plan your movements around circle phases, not around where you think enemies might be.

Daily target: 150-200 RP gain. The gains slow down, but consistency matters more than big point swings.

Day 5-7: Ace to Conqueror Final Push

The home stretch. 8-12 matches daily, focusing on consistent top 5 finishes. This is where Rating Protection Cards become essential - use them strategically during uncertain matches.

Here’s an insider tip: monitor the Conqueror leaderboard obsessively. Early season, the first 500 players to hit Ace often get automatic Conqueror status. I’ve seen players hit Conqueror at 4200 RP simply because they were fast enough.

Daily target: 100-150 RP gain.

Solo Mode Ranking Strategies

Solo is a different beast entirely. Lower tiers? Balanced aggression works. Crown+? You become a ghost.

Master the art of disengagement. Smoke grenades aren’t just for revives - they’re your escape tools. Keep vehicles nearby but ditch them before final circles (nothing screams shoot me like engine noise in top 10).

Hot dropping can work, but only at location edges. Grab a weapon, get 2-3 quick kills, then vanish. Don’t get greedy.

Final circles demand edge play. Center positioning is for squads with coordination. You’re alone - use rocks, trees, anything for cover. DP-28 in prone position? That’s how you control open areas.

Duo Mode Optimization Tactics

Establish roles immediately: one long-range support, one close-quarters specialist. Maintain 50-100 meter spacing during rotations - close enough for support, far enough to avoid simultaneous elimination.

Bait and switch becomes your bread and butter. One player draws attention while the partner flanks. It’s simple, but execution under pressure separates good duos from great ones.

Never loot immediately after eliminations. Smoke first, secure the area, then loot. Carry extra medical supplies and share energy drinks/painkillers religiously.

Squad Mode Team Composition

Optimal composition needs clear roles: IGL (calls the shots), Entry Fragger (leads pushes), Long-Range Support (overwatch), Support Player (utilities/revives).

Diamond formation with 75-100 meter spacing during rotations. Squad fights require synchronized focus fire - pick one target, eliminate them, move to the next. Don’t spread damage across multiple enemies.

Coordinate utilities like you’re conducting an orchestra: smoke for revives/rotations, frags for flushing enemies, molotovs for area denial. Post-fight protocol: immediate healing, ammo redistribution, security overwatch before anyone touches a loot box.

Map-Specific Strategies for C9S26

Comparison of PUBG Mobile maps showing Erangel, Sanhok, and Miramar strategic locations

Erangel: Your point-farming paradise. Target Georgopol, Yasnaya Polyana, Primorsk for that sweet balance of loot and manageable combat. Central hills provide excellent overwatch positions, coastal areas offer boat escape routes. Vehicle spawns are abundant - use this to your advantage for flexible rotations.

Sanhok: Compact and chaotic. Hot drop Bootcamp or Paradise Resort if you’re feeling aggressive, or hit cave systems and temples for safer gear acquisition. The compact size means faster circles and constant encounters - maintain threat awareness at all times.

Miramar: Long-range paradise. DP-28 and Mini-14 become your best friends. Control compounds like Hacienda del Patrón through superior positioning. Vehicle dependency is real here due to vast distances - manage fuel carefully or you’ll be running through open desert.

Weapon Meta and Loadout Optimization

PUBG Mobile optimal weapon loadouts showing M416, AKM, and UMP45 with attachments

Tier 1 Weapons: M416 remains the most versatile option with manageable recoil. AKM delivers 48 damage per shot with the fastest TTK under 30 meters. UMP45 excels in stealth and CQC with suppressor compatibility.

Optimal Combinations:

  • M416 + Mini-14 (versatile range coverage)

  • AKM + DP-28 (aggressive CQC + long-range control)

  • UMP45 + M416 (urban environments)

Attachment Priority: Compensators provide immediate recoil improvement. Extended magazines enable sustained fire. Tactical stocks reduce sway and recoil. Match scopes to your engagement range preferences.

Common Ranking Mistakes to Avoid

Don’t play while tilted. Seriously. Take breaks after 2-3 consecutive losses. I’ve watched players lose 500+ RP in tilt sessions that could’ve been avoided with a 30-minute break.

Stop spreading time across multiple modes. Pick one leaderboard and commit. Learn when to disengage rather than forcing unfavorable fights. Your ego isn’t worth -40 RP.

Schedule sessions during off-peak hours when casual players dominate lobbies. Quality beats quantity every time - five focused matches outperform fifteen rushed games.

Performance Tracking and Analytics

Monitor your average placement, survival rating, and damage per match religiously. Survival rating is your most important ranking metric - consistent top 10 finishes outvalue occasional high-kill games.

Use third-party tracking tools for detailed statistics. Establish daily RP targets based on your current tier and remaining time. Document what works and review match replays for positioning errors.

Statistical analysis reveals your optimal loadout choices and map preferences. Don’t guess - let the data guide your decisions.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many matches per day are needed to reach Conqueror in 7 days? Days 1-2: 15-20 matches for aggressive gains. Days 3-4: 10-15 matches with placement focus. Days 5-7: 8-12 matches using Rating Protection Cards. Expect 6-10 hours daily depending on match duration and your efficiency.

Which game mode offers the fastest path to Conqueror? FPP Solo and Duo modes provide the easiest access (4200-5000 RP vs 5000-7000 RP for TPP Squad) due to smaller player pools. Choose based on your strengths: strong solo combat skills = FPP Solo, team coordination preference = Squad mode.

What survival rating is needed for Conqueror? Generally 2.5-4.0 survival rating, but consistent top 10 placement matters more than specific numbers. Once you hit Crown tier, prioritize final circle reaches over kill counts.

When should I use Rating Protection Cards? Activate before uncertain matches in Crown/Ace tiers where point penalties are severe. Cards aren’t consumed if you gain points, making them risk-free insurance. Save them for high-stakes situations rather than lower tiers.

What time is optimal for ranking? Early morning (6-10 AM) and late evening (10 PM-2 AM) feature less skilled opposition. Avoid prime time (6-10 PM) when professional players are most active. Monitor your personal win rates across different time periods to find your sweet spot.

How to maintain KD while pushing ranks quickly? Lower tiers: aggressive play with 3-5 kills supports both KD and RP. Crown+: survival-first with 1-2 kills per match. Use third-party tactics for safer eliminations and disengage unfavorable fights immediately. Your KD might take a temporary hit, but Conqueror is worth it.
